Learn the country in which your Dodge was constructed by reading the first digit of the VIN. The number 1 would indicate it was manufactured in the United States; the number 2 would indicate it was manufactured in Canada. Read the second digit of the VIN to determine the make of the Dodge. For example, a Dodge will have the letter B, a Chrysler still a Dodge product would display the letter C, and a Plymouth would display the letter P.

Discover the vehicle type by reading the third digit of the VIN. For example, a passenger car would display the number 3 and a truck would be a number 7. Determine the gross vehicle weight by reading the fourth digit. On some older VINs, this digit also conveyed certain safety features on the Dodge. Read the fifth digit of the VIN to learn the vehicle line. This determines the model and type of Dodge you have--for example, a sedan Neon, a coupe Stealth, a four-wheel-drive Dakota or a two-wheel-drive Ram.

Learn the series of the model from the sixth digit. Count over to the seventh digit of the VIN on your Dodge to learn the body type of the vehicle--whether it's a hatchback, a wagon, a van, a four-door pickup or some other.

Determine the engine code from the eighth digit. This number reveals what size motor is in your Dodge, and separates it from a similar motor manufactured in the same year that may use different parts. This is an important number with which to provide parts stores, repair shops and the dealership service with part-replacement information.
